Black mulch installation involves spreading a layer of dark-colored mulch over garden beds, landscaping areas, or around trees and shrubs. This service typically includes preparing the existing soil, removing any old or degraded mulch, and then carefully laying down fresh black mulch to create a uniform and attractive appearance. The process may also involve edging to define the borders of planting beds, ensuring the mulch stays in place, and sometimes adding a weed barrier beneath the mulch to prevent unwanted growth. Professional contractors focus on delivering a clean, even application that enhances the overall look of outdoor spaces.
This service helps address several common landscaping problems. It can suppress weeds, reducing the need for frequent maintenance and chemical weed control. Black mulch also helps retain soil moisture, which benefits plant health during dry periods by reducing water evaporation. Additionally, the dark color provides a striking contrast that can make flowers, greenery, and other landscape features stand out more vividly. For property owners dealing with uneven or patchy soil, mulch installation can create a more polished and cohesive outdo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Black Mulch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Ramon,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Mulch Installations - Typical projects for smaller areas, such as garden beds or walkways, usually c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and type of mulch used.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her prices but are less common in this category.
Full Mulch Replacement - Replacing existing mulch over larger landscape areas often costs between $600 and $1,200. Most homeowners in San Ramon, CA, see projects in this range, with fewer projects pushing into the higher tiers for extensive or detailed work. The total cost varies based on the size and accessibility of the area.
Bulk Mulch Delivery and Installation - For significant quantities of mulch, such as several cubic yards, costs typically range from $300 to $900. Many local contractors offer discounts for large orders, making this a common choice for larger landscaping projects. Prices increase with the volume and type of mulch selected.
Complex or Custom Mulch Projects - Larger, more intricate installations, including decorative mulching or multi-area landscaping, can range from $1,200 to $5,000+ depending on scope and design details. These projects are less frequent and often involve specialized materials or features, which influence the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
